I got a pretty good confirmation that this pommel was urethane. My cast was an olive/beige resin and showed scratches and wrinkles. Not plated.

This pommel has a milling mistake, and it (had) sharp T shaped patterns between the cubes. I lost some of that detail cleaning the darned thing up. :(

These do not match the hero pommels, so another master was made for the rubber stunts, maybe the bladed ones too, I don’t know

For my purposes, I’m using acrylic lacquer, like they used in Ep. 1
